Best type of non key lock for wooden garden gate?
Elliot Trussell 03/03/2026 - 7.58 AM
Hi - I have a mechanical keypad lock on my wooden garden gate. However as the wooden gate swells and shrinks in weather, the lock mechanism is very inconsistent and code entry often does not work. What type of non-key lock is a better solution for outdoor wooden gates? (I don’t want a key based lock as I keep a spare house key in a lock box in the garden for when I get locked out)

A Yale connect would work well, it's all digital and can be unlocked via Keypad (touch), fobs , phone and remotely , no keys required, but you would need a waterproof box if the battery cover is exposed to weather
